Placing the Bet in Canada's AI Strategy
This announcement does not exist in a vacuum. It is the latest move in a long-running national project to secure Canada's position as a global AI leader. Since launching the Pan-Canadian Artificial Intelligence Strategy (PCAIS) in 2017, the country has rightly earned a reputation for world-class foundational research, anchored by institutes like Mila in Montreal, the Vector Institute in Toronto, and Amii in Edmonton.
However, Canada's persistent challenge has been translating that academic brilliance into commercial success and domestic economic value. For every breakthrough in a Canadian university lab, there is a story of a promising startup being acquired by a foreign giant or a top-tier researcher being lured south by higher salaries and greater resources. It is the classic Canadian "innovation gap," a valley of death between research and revenue.
This is where tomorrow's investment comes in. It is almost certainly an instrument of the PCAIS's second phase: a concerted push toward commercialization and adoption. The explicit mention of a "Canadian-made" application is critical. It signals a protectionist-lite stance, a desire to ensure that the intellectual property and the resulting economic benefits remain within our borders. As one industry analyst commented, "We’ve been fantastic at funding the first mile of the AI race. This is about ensuring we’re still in the race for the last mile, where the real value is captured."
Following the massive $2.4 billion commitment to AI in the 2024 federal budget—earmarked for compute capacity and safety initiatives—this specific application funding is a tactical deployment. It’s a move from building the national highways for AI to funding the specific vehicles that will drive on them. The government is no longer just a patron of research; it is now acting as a strategic venture capitalist, placing a bet on a specific horse it believes can win.
The Humber College Signal: Nurturing the Roots of Innovation
Perhaps the most revealing detail of all is the venue: Humber College’s Lakeshore Campus. Not the University of Toronto’s Schwartz Reisman Innovation Centre. Not a gleaming downtown tech incubator. A community college in Etobicoke.
This choice speaks volumes about the government’s understanding of what a truly sustainable technology ecosystem requires. While universities produce the PhDs who invent next-generation neural networks, it is colleges like Humber that produce the vast workforce of developers, data technicians, IT specialists, and project managers required to implement, scale, and maintain those innovations.
By hosting the event at Humber, Ottawa is signaling that its AI strategy is about more than just elite research. It is about building a deep and diverse talent pipeline. It acknowledges that for every AI visionary, a company needs a team of skilled practitioners to turn vision into reality. This is a grassroots approach to industrial strategy, recognizing that innovation must be connected to community, applied skills, and accessible education. It suggests a potential for future collaborations, co-op programs, and curriculum development aimed at ensuring the local workforce is prepared for the jobs this investment will create. It is a powerful statement that Canada’s AI future will be built not only in research labs but also in the classrooms of its community colleges.
